estar en una situación complicada - Spanish English Dictionary

estar en una situación complicada

Play ENESESes
Play ENESESmx

Meanings of "estar en una situación complicada" in English Spanish Dictionary : 1 result(s)

Spanish English
Idioms
estar en una situación complicada [v] come to a pretty pass